Daily Market Highlights (21.01.14)

  • The MSE Share Index slid 0.4% today back to 3,666.317 points due to the declines in HSBC, IHI and FIMBank which offset the increases in another six equities including BOV. Download a copy of the Equity Market Summary.
  • On the bond market, the Rizzo Farrugia MGS Index eased minimally lower to 1,026.905 points as Eurozone yields marginally rebounded possibly on some profit-taking following the recent slide in benchmark yields. Nonetheless, the region’s yields slid back to the 1.745% level by this afternoon reflecting the unexpected drop in German economic sentiment as well as the USD42 billion injection into the Chinese economy by the Bank of China.
  • BOV’s share price touched a new six-year high of €2.50 (equivalent to €2.75 pre-bonus) before marginally easing to a close of €2.49 which still represents a 1.6% increase over the previous closing price. Volumes remained healthy with over 74,500 shares of BOV changing hands during today’s session.
  • Meanwhile, the share price of HSBC slipped by 2% to the €2.52 level across nineteen deals totalling 60,700 shares. The Bank is scheduled to publish its 2013 full-year results on 24 February.
  • Amongst the large cap equities, GO ended this morning’s session minimally higher at €1.85 after recovering from an intra-day low of €1.80 across five deals totalling 14,172 shares.
  • In the financial services sector, the share price of Middlesea Insurance surpassed the €0.92 level for the first time since August 2011 with a 0.3% increase to the €0.923 level across 4,220 shares.
  • Lombard Bank held on to yesterday’s gains and closed unchanged at the €1.90 level on volumes of 9,638 shares.
  • On the other hand, the equity of FIMBank eased 0.5% lower to US$0.955 on volumes of 3,400 shares. Yesterday marked the closing of the voluntary bid by Burgan Bank and United Gulf Bank and the results are expected to be published in the coming days.
  • The equity of Simonds Farsons Cisk also experienced low volumes with a single trade of 2,491 shares executed at the €2.90 level representing a 0.4% increase over the previous close.
  • Similarly, IHI edged 2.4% lower to €0.898 on a small trade of 544 shares.
  • There were marginal changes in the equities of MIA, RS2 and 6pm on shallow activity.
